The Future of Surgery: Apple Vision Pro's Role in Enhancing Medical Outcomes
Apple's Vision Pro headset is making unexpected but impressive strides in the healthcare sector, proving to be a versatile tool for medical professionals globally. When Apple unveiled Vision Pro, an extended reality (XR) headset, last year, very few anticipated its potential to transform surgical outcomes and patient care. Yet, from bariatric surgeries to spinal operations, doctors around the world are using this technology to achieve remarkable results.
Pioneering use in bariatric surgery
In New Delhi, a groundbreaking bariatric surgery marked the first use of Vision Pro in the field. The 40-minute procedure on a 45-year-old patient, who weighed 155 kg and suffered from hypertension and obstructive sleep apnea, was a success. The immersive 3D environment provided by Vision Pro allowed the surgical team to view complex anatomical structures with unprecedented clarity.
Dr Vaibhav Kapoor, Co-Founder of Pristyn Care, where the surgery took place, lauded the integration of Vision Pro, saying, “The successful integration of Apple Vision Pro into bariatric surgery is a significant milestone in our journey to revolutionize surgical procedures.” Dr Mohit Bhandari, a leading bariatric surgeon involved in the procedure, echoed these sentiments, adding that this technology opens up new possibilities for surgical precision and improved patient outcomes.
Advances in Laparoscopic Surgery
At GEM Hospital in Chennai, surgeons are using Vision Pro for laparoscopic surgery. Dr R Parthasarathy, Surgical Gastroenterologist and COO of GEM Hospital, highlighted the device’s real-time transmission and improved visualization capabilities. He explained, “There is no delay in transmission. My vision was better and I was connected to the real world. Whatever I can see on the monitor displaying the laparoscopic surgery, can be seen on this device as well.” Additionally, the ability to simultaneously view CT scans and magnify internal organs to wall-sized dimensions provides remarkable detail and utility, especially for consulting specialists during procedures.
Global adoption and success stories
The impact of Vision Pro extends beyond India. In Brazil, surgeons used the headset for shoulder arthroscopy, while in the U.K., it was used during a delicate spine surgery at Cromwell Hospital. Interestingly, in this case, the nurse wore the headset, providing the necessary assistance and increasing surgical accuracy. Nurse Suvi Verho described this technology as a “game-changer,” emphasizing its role in reducing guesswork and human error. Surgeon Syed Aftab compared the experience to collaborating with an experienced professional, highlighting the headset’s assistive capabilities.
In Florida, USA, Vision Pro was used in a shoulder-joint replacement procedure, further demonstrating its versatility across different surgical disciplines.
Revolutionizing medical technology
The Vision Pro is not only a surgical aid but also a tool for a wide range of medical applications. Its apps, such as Stryker's MyMako for detailed 3D surgical planning and Siemens Healthineers' human anatomy tool for clinical and educational purposes, are revolutionizing medical technology. Cedars-Sinai's Zia app provides AI-powered mental health support and virtual meditation, showcasing the headset's potential in holistic healthcare.
